X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;ds=sidebyside;f=inc%2Fmodules%2Fadmin%2Fwhat-config_secure.php;h=2f9e327ce6157f5fbb84e21ff3c845b762fba180;hb=6586600d8020147192e5f28ca2a3a0153f774d3c;hp=d065ee051bdebeb2cd3a6f7b740ed875939791e5;hpb=75ad748a68473ace540251427a74fb781b1145e9;p=mailer.git diff --git a/inc/modules/admin/what-config_secure.php b/inc/modules/admin/what-config_secure.php index d065ee051b..2f9e327ce6 100644 --- a/inc/modules/admin/what-config_secure.php +++ b/inc/modules/admin/what-config_secure.php @@ -32,15 +32,12 @@ ************************************************************************/ // Some security stuff... -if ((ereg(basename(__FILE__), $_SERVER['PHP_SELF'])) || (!IS_ADMIN())) -{ +if ((!defined('__SECURITY')) || (!IS_ADMIN())) { $INC = substr(dirname(__FILE__), 0, strpos(dirname(__FILE__), "/inc") + 4) . "/security.php"; require($INC); } -global $link; - // Add description as navigation point -ADD_DESCR("admin", basename(__FILE__)); +ADD_DESCR("admin", __FILE__); if (isset($_POST['ok'])) { @@ -54,19 +51,19 @@ if (isset($_POST['ok'])) unset($_POST['salt_length']); // Redirect to logout link - LOAD_URL(URL."/modules.php?module=admin&logout=1"); + LOAD_URL("modules.php?module=admin&logout=1"); } // Save settings - ADMIN_SAVE_SETTINGS($_POST, "_config", "config='0'"); + ADMIN_SAVE_SETTINGS($_POST); } else { // Remember stuff in constants - define('__PASS_LEN' , $CONFIG['pass_len']); + define('__PASS_LEN' , $_CONFIG['pass_len']); // Password-salt length - define('__SALT_LENGTH', $CONFIG['salt_length']); + define('__SALT_LENGTH', $_CONFIG['salt_length']); // Load template LOAD_TEMPLATE("admin_config_secure");